Vista Plantation Golf Course
About
Vista Plantation Golf Club is an Arthur Hills-designed course that is conveniently located near all of Vero Beach's attractions. The course is just a short drive from the scenic beaches, which are part of Florida's Treasure Coast. The course is compact but challenging with small, fast greens and tight fairways. Water hazards also come into play on a few holes. The golf course is challenging enough for avid players yet forgiving enough for high handicappers to approach with confidence. It's a player-friendly layout that is great for beginners and seniors. Though the golf course may not require distance, your short game skills will be put to the test. There is not only water but also numerous strategically placed bunkers. Vista Plantation is a golf course that will make you think and you'll also need to be accurate.
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ue | 62 | 3697 yards | 60.1 | 104 |
| White | 62 | 3448 yards | 59.2 | 102 |
| Teal | 62 | 3141 yards | 57.9 | 98 |
| Red | 62 | 3006 yards | 56.3 | 93 |
| Red (W) | 62 | 3006 yards | 57.8 | 87 |
